Stan Hints at Shaking up the Starting Lineup to Limit Turnovers
Posted on 1/10/21 at 10:49 am
Posted on 1/10/21 at 10:49 am
quote:
After the game, Van Gundy brought up Dick Bennett, the longtime Wisconsin-Green Bay coach who in the ‘80s and ‘90s built the school into a mid-major power. Bennett spent 10 seasons there. In nine of them, the Phoenix averaged fewer turnovers than their opponents.
“My brother had gone to one of his practices,” Van Gundy said. “He asked him, ‘What do you you guys work on to cut the turnovers?’ He said, ‘It’s the simplest thing in the world. Don’t play the guys who turn it over.’ I don’t want to get to that. Because some of those guys, we need. And some of those guys have to create shots. But we can’t have everybody out on the floor turning the ball over. We need some guys in our starting lineup, especially, who will take care of the ball.”
LINK
So who is going to the bench? Lonzo for JJ or Hart makes the most sense I guess.
